Course Content

• Refugee Education Funding Landscape
• Grant Writing and Proposal Development for Refugee Education
• Financial Management and Budget Control in Refugee Aid
• Monitoring and Evaluation of Refugee Education Programmes
• Risk Management and Compliance in Refugee Funding
• Stakeholder Engagement and Communication for Refugee Projects
• Strategic Planning for Refugee Education Initiatives
• Capacity Building and Training in Refugee Education Funding Management

Career path

Career Role Description
Refugee Education Programme Manager Oversees all aspects of refugee education programs, ensuring effective funding management and program implementation. Strong leadership and project management skills are essential.
Funding Officer (Education, Refugee Focus) Responsible for securing funding for educational initiatives supporting refugees. Requires expertise in grant writing, budget management, and fundraising.
Education Program Evaluator (Refugee Sector) Evaluates the effectiveness of refugee education programs, analyzing data and providing recommendations for improvement. Strong analytical and reporting skills are required.
Refugee Integration Specialist (Education Focus) Develops and implements strategies to support the integration of refugees into the UK education system. Requires cultural sensitivity and strong communication skills.
